{¶1} In this appeal, Kimberly and Mama Diallo contest the decision of the Hamilton County Juvenile Court awarding permanent custody of their son, S.D., to the Hamilton County Department of Job and Family Services ("HCJFS"). For the following reasons, we affirm.
